Rock prevents evaporation as it CANNOT absorb water, water cannot pass through it to evaporate like it can through mulch, and the surface area of rock would be much lower for evaporation. Mulch works like an insulation and between rocks and organic mulch such as bark, cedar etc it's the better choice hands down this is what everyone recommends where freezes occur it also helps to regulate soil temperature better which means a certain layer of organic mulch keeps roots from freezing or in the summer from overheating another benefit to it is giving the soil a better ph level . I mulch all the palms I grow with wood mulch, except two, 1 being chamaerops humilis, the other washingtonia filifera.
